What We Recommend for Alfa Romeo Giulia Owners

If you want to replicate this look, stick to an 8.5-inch width up front and a 10-inch width in the rear. A square setup is easier to rotate, but the staggered look defines the spirit of this Italian sedan. We always prefer the staggered stance for the best visual balance.

Aim for an offset in the mid-30s to keep the scrub radius close to factory specs. You want to avoid pushing the wheels out too far or you will ruin the way the car handles. Keep the steering geometry as close to the engineers' original plan as you can.

Do not go overboard with tire stretch unless you want a show-only car. We recommend a performance tire with a square shoulder to fill out the Rotiform barrel properly. A 245 front and 275 rear tire combo works wonders for grip and aesthetics.

Avoid cheap hub-centric rings if you can find a wheel that matches the Alfa bore directly. We have seen too many plastic rings melt or crack after a spirited mountain run. Quality hardware ensures you do not end up stranded on the side of the road.

Watch your tire pressure closely when you move to a lower profile sidewall. These wheels look incredible, but they provide less cushion against nasty potholes. Check your pressures weekly to protect your investment from impact damage.

We talk to Alfa Romeo Giulia owners every day. These are the questions we hear most before they pull the trigger on new wheels.

Will 19-inch wheels fit my Alfa Romeo Giulia? Yes, but fitment depends on width, offset, and tire size working together. A wrong offset means rubbing. A wrong tire size means poor handling. Always verify all three.

Do I need to modify my fenders? That depends on your offset and suspension. A conservative offset with stock ride height usually fits without modification. Go aggressive and you may need to roll or pull your fenders.

Can I daily-drive this setup? Absolutely. Thousands of Alfa Romeo Giulia owners run 19-inch wheels every day. The key is choosing the right tire with enough sidewall to absorb road imperfections.
